Romania, U.S. agree on missile shield site (UPDATE)

previous news was posted at 14:10

Romania and the United States have agreed to deploy missile interceptors at Deveselu air base in southern Romania as part of a missile defense shield, Romanian President Traian Basescu said Tuesday, Xinhua reported.

"We have agreed that the location for the anti-missile system to be set up should be the former air base at Deveselu in Olt County," Basescu said, adding that "the air base stays under the Romanian command and part of the area of the base will be used by the American anti-missile system."

The president reiterated the U.S. missile defense shield is a defensive, not an offensive system and is in no way directed at Russia.
